Overview

Printed Circuit Boards (PCBs) are the backbone of modern electronic devices, providing a platform for mounting and interconnecting electronic components. They are widely used in consumer electronics, industrial equipment, medical devices, and automotive systems. PCBs are manufactured using layers of conductive and insulating materials, with copper traces etched to form electrical pathways. Their design and complexity vary depending on the application, ranging from simple single-layer boards to multi-layer high-density interconnect (HDI) boards.

Structure and Working Principle

A PCB consists of a non-conductive substrate (typically fiberglass or epoxy) with conductive copper traces laminated onto its surface. These traces form circuits that connect components like resistors, capacitors, and integrated circuits. Multi-layer PCBs stack several conductive layers separated by insulating material, allowing for more complex circuitry in a compact form. Vias (plated holes) enable electrical connections between layers. The working principle relies on these traces and vias to route electrical signals efficiently between components.

Key Features

PCBs offer several advantages, including reliability, compactness, and scalability. They eliminate the need for bulky wiring, reducing the size and weight of electronic devices. Modern PCBs support high-frequency signals and miniaturization, making them ideal for advanced applications like 5G technology and IoT devices. Features like impedance control, thermal management, and flexible designs (flex PCBs) further enhance their versatility.

Application Areas

PCBs are ubiquitous in electronics, found in smartphones, computers, televisions, and wearable devices. Industrial applications include automation systems, power supplies, and control panels. In the automotive sector, PCBs are used in engine control units, infotainment systems, and advanced driver-assistance systems (ADAS). Medical devices like MRI machines and pacemakers also rely on high-reliability PCBs.

Maintenance and Precautions

Proper handling and storage are critical to maintaining PCB integrity. Exposure to moisture, dust, or extreme temperatures can damage the board or its components. During installation, avoid mechanical stress or bending, especially for rigid PCBs. For repairs, use appropriate soldering techniques and avoid overheating. Regular inspections can help detect issues like trace corrosion or component failure early.

B2B Procurement Guide

When sourcing PCBs, consider factors like material quality, layer count, and manufacturing tolerances. High-frequency applications may require specialized materials like Rogers or Teflon. Work with reputable suppliers who adhere to industry standards (e.g., IPC-A-600). Request samples and test reports to verify performance. For large orders, negotiate volume discounts and ensure the supplier can meet lead times.
